An approach of near infrared image accurate orientation and recognition

摘要

This paper proposes an edge extraction algorithm of near infrared image based on 2-spline wavelet transform. Through Hough transform of edge image, object image''s circle structure can be detected, and object image also has an accurate orientation. So we can extract special figure features of object image. Then near infrared images are classified by statistical template matching. All algorithms which are simple and efficient are compiled in VC++ 6.0. The experimental results show that exact digital image processing method can be applied in the field of differentiating paper currency instead of manual judging. This paper is about a new field of infrared image application and a new direction in differentiating the true and the counterfeit.
